The 2022 Hyundai Elantra SE is the base model for the masses
The new 2022 Hyundai Elantra SE is a dazzling choice for most drivers. As a base trim, this is one of the most impressive options available, especially with a starting price of $19,950. The new Elantra SE comes with a 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ine that will create 147 horsepower and 132 lb.-ft. of torque. It will utilize a Smartstream Intelligent Variable Transmission to bring you a smooth delivery of power and more efficiency.
Thanks to its interior, this new sedan will be a top-notch choice for more drivers. The interior includes cloth seating, an eight-inch infotainment display, wireless Apple CarPlay, wireless Android Auto, dual USB ports, and power windows. Additional features will include Forward Collision-Avoidance Assist with pedestrian Detection, Blind-Spot Collision-Avoidance Assist, Rear Cross-traffic Collision-Avoidance Assist, Lane Keeping Assist, Lane Following Assist, Driver Attention Warning, High Beam Assist, and Safe Exit Warning.
A 2022 Hyundai Elantra SEL packs in the features
If you are looking for a compact sedan that stands out , choose the 2022 Hyundai Elantra SEL. At $21,200, this trim is a smart choice for any shopper. Taking just one step up in the line-up will allow you to enjoy many more features and technologies.
One of the biggest additions to this trim level is that Forward Collision-Avoidance Assist with pedestrian, Cyclist and Junction-Turning Detection, and Smart Cruise Control with Stop & Go are now available. Furthermore, features can now include heated side mirrors, a sunroof, heated front seats, wireless device charging, and dual-zone climate controls for your comfort.
Consider a 2022 Hyundai Elantra N-Line for a sportier drive
When you need something that will be more fun than your average sedan, choose the 2022 Hyundai Elantra N-Line. With a starting price of $24,350, this sporty sedan is ready for more drivers. Powering this sedan is a 1.6-liter turbocharged four-cylinder engine that can bring you 201 horsepower and 195 lb.-ft. of torque. Furthermore, this engine is paired with a six-speed manual transmission as standard. There is also aa seven-speed Dual-Clutch Transmission available for a small cost.
On the inside, the N-Line can now come standard with leather and cloth combination sport seats, a power driver seat, alloy sport pedals, wireless charging, a unique N Line steering wheel, and shift knob, a unique gauge cluster, and the Hyundai Digital Key.
Choose a 2022 Hyundai Elantra Limited for the best selection of features

Drivers flock to the Hyundai Elantra because of its friendly price. The final trim level, the Limited, brings you incredible features at a particularly great price! This trim starts at just $25,700 and features significant changes to the interior. Drivers and passengers will love the inclusion of every driver assistance technology from the above models, plus Highway Drive Assist, parking Collision-Avoidance Assist-Reverse, and Parking Distance Warning-Reverse. Plus, drivers and passengers can enjoy leather seating, a 10.25-inch infotainment display, wired Apple CarPlay, wired Android Auto, a premium Bose audio system with eight speakers, a 10.25-inch digital gauge cluster, and interior ambient lighting.
